Killarney-Glengarry
Killarney-Glengarry is known for its urban forest of mature trees and close links to downtown – aided by the new West LRT line. It is an area that is growing and changing as it attracts developers marketing homes to young families who want to be close to downtown but with the amenities of a suburb.
The community has recently undergone tremendous redevelopment, with many newer in-fill homes replacing the original properties.

Killarney-Glengarry has a population of 6,816 living in 3,679 dwellings. Residents in this community have a median household income of $53,799 and there are 19.5% low income residents living in the neighbourhood.
Killarney residents are close to several parks, including the Optimist Athletic Park which has:
- soccer fields
- softball fields
- field hockey
- lacrosse, football and 8 ball diamonds including 1 little league diamond
The community also has Killarney Aquatic and Recreation Centre:
- swimming
- dancing
- martial arts or fitness classes.
- Fitness classes and a state-of-the-art weight room will challenge your fitness level.
- a number of registered and drop-in aquatic and fitness classes.
Avid golfers will enjoy living in this area because Richmond Green Golf Course and Shaganappi Point Golf Course are nearby.
The Killarney-Glengarry Community Association provides ample resources for residents, including a Main Hall chock-full of rental facilities, programs for children and seniors, and even block parties. Community gardens hosted by the association are a gathering place for the summer months.

Killarney-Glengarry is a great, safe neighbourhood for families and is home to several schools in and around the area:
Public Elementary:
- Sir James Lougheed (K-1)
- Killarney (Gr. 2-6)
- Alexander Ferguson (Gr. K-6)
- Westgate (French)
Catholic Elementary:
- St. T. Aquinas
- Holy Name (French)
- St. Michael
Public Junior High:
- A.E. Cross
- Vincent Massey
- Bishop Pinkham (French)
Catholic Junior High:
- St. Gregory (4-9)
- St. Michael
Public Senior High:
- Ernest Manning
- Western Canada (French)
